Looking for something unique this Valentine’s Day? Fall in love with the natural world at the Valentine’s Silent Disco at the Natural History Museum in South Kensington. This special after-hours event offers a blend of captivating nature photography and dancing under the iconic blue whale skeleton, Hope.

Why You Should Attend the Valentine’s Silent Disco Party at the Natural History Museum in South Kensington

Start the evening with an exclusive Wildlife Photographer of the Year exhibition, showcasing stunning natural world images in the Museum’s sixtieth exhibition. Afterward, grab a cocktail and hit the dance floor at the Silent Disco under Hope, the Museum’s blue whale. It’s an unforgettable way to celebrate Valentine’s Day!
